Sodium in PDB 4zb6: Crystal Structure of Glutathione Transferase URE2P4 From Phanerochaete Chrysosporium in Complex with Oxidized Glutathione.

Protein crystallography data

The structure of Crystal Structure of Glutathione Transferase URE2P4 From Phanerochaete Chrysosporium in Complex with Oxidized Glutathione., PDB code: 4zb6 was solved by T.Roret, C.Didierjean,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 47.00 / 1.80
Space group P 21 21 21
Cell size a, b, c (Å), α, β, γ (°) 92.437, 94.059, 104.627, 90.00, 90.00, 90.00
R / Rfree (%) 16.3 / 19

Sodium Binding Sites:

The binding sites of Sodium atom in the Crystal Structure of Glutathione Transferase URE2P4 From Phanerochaete Chrysosporium in Complex with Oxidized Glutathione. (pdb code 4zb6). This binding sites where shown within 5.0 Angstroms radius around Sodium atom.
In total 4 binding sites of Sodium where determined in the Crystal Structure of Glutathione Transferase URE2P4 From Phanerochaete Chrysosporium in Complex with Oxidized Glutathione., PDB code: 4zb6:
